Question:

Graham joined two congruent square pyramids to form the composite solid. 2 square pyramids are connected at their base. [Not drawn to scale] If the lateral faces of the pyramids each have an area of 18.4 cm², what is the total surface area of the composite solid?

a) 73.6 cm²

b) 110.4 cm²

c) 147.2 cm²

d) 158.2 cm²

Answer:

c) 147.2 cm²

Step-by-step explanation:

We are told in the question that two congruent square pyramids are connected at their base to form a composite solid.

It is important to note that a square pyramid has 4 lateral faces and one base. When two congruent square pyramids are connected at their base to form a composite solid, the total number of lateral faces of the composite solid = 8 lateral faces.

To calculate the total surface area of the composite solid = Sum of the area of Lateral faces of the pyramid.

In the question we are given the area of each of the faces of the lateral pyramid as 18.4cm². Since we have 8 lateral faces for the composite solid,

The total surface area of the composite solid = (18.4 cm² × 8)

= 147.2 cm²

Or 18.4 cm² + 18.4 cm² + 18.4 cm² + 18.4 cm² + 18.4 cm² + 18.4 cm² + 18.4 cm² + 18.4 cm²

= 147.2 cm²
